Data Viz Room \n\n\nPrior-knowledge Guided Machine-learning Enabled Metalens Antenna Design\nAbstract –  The design of antennas aims to meet the specific requirements of a system. This design relies on materials\, fabrication processes\, and design methodologies. Besides natural materials\, we have introduced metamaterials—artificially engineered structures that exhibit unique electromagnetic properties not found in nature—to expand the boundaries of antenna design. Furthermore\, we have explored new design methodologies to extend these boundaries. \nTraditionally\, antenna design begins with basic designs\, which are then modified or optimized to meet the specifications. However\, this approach has limitations in achieving optimal performance due to constrained degrees of freedom (DoF). These limitations arise from physical constraints such as volume restrictions and feeding structures\, as well as restricted design space regarding the selection of viable structures or parameters in the design process. Therefore\, deep learning algorithms are being utilized to significantly increase the degrees of freedom (DoF) in antenna design. This will expand the antenna design space and hold promise for enhancing antenna performance. \nThis talk will focus on outlining innovative approaches to antenna design. Specifically\, it will explore the prior-knowledge-guided deep learning-enabled synthesis method and demonstrate its utility in enhancing the performance of metacells and metalens antennas. \nBio – Professor Zhi Ning Chen got his two PhD degrees in China in 1993 and in Japan in 2003\, respectively.
